matlab.exception. Класс JavaException

Пакет: matlab.exception

Получите информацию об ошибке для исключения Java

Описание

Информация о процессе от объекта matlab.exception.JavaException обработать ошибки Java®, выданные методами Java, названными от MATLAB®. Этот класс выведен от MException.

Создание

Вы не создаете объект matlab.exception.JavaException явным образом. MATLAB автоматически создает объект JavaException каждый раз, когда Java выдает исключение. Объект JavaException переносит исходное исключение Java.

Свойства

развернуть все

Объект исключения Java, который вызвал ошибку, заданную как объект java.lang.Throwable.

Примеры

свернуть все

Добавьте объект matlab.exception.JavaException к оператору try-catch.

try
    java.lang.Class.forName('myfunction');
catch e
    e.message
    if(isa(e,'matlab.exception.JavaException'))
        ex = e.ExceptionObject;
        assert(isjava(ex));
        ex.printStackTrace;
    end
end

Представленный в R2012b

Была ли эта тема полезной?